Our Opportunity
We have a fantastic opportunity for a Head of Bid Management to work within our Training and Simulation UK business. This business delivers training across air, land and sea and is the leading provider of land training services across Europe. We have an exciting future ahead as we pursue growth from our heritage business, as well as newer, digital offerings.
As Head of Bid Management, your role will include a dynamic blend of responsibilities, emphasising not only the successful delivery of bids but also the strategic management and nurturing of a team of bid professionals. This position plays a critical role in managing our sales and prospect pipeline and being a key interface to the Business Winning functions.

In line with Thales' Baseline Security requirements, candidates will be asked to provide evidence of identity, eligibility to work in the UK and employment and/or education history for up to three years. Some vacancies may require full Security Clearance which can require further evidence to be provided. For further details of the evidence required to apply for Baseline and Security Clearance please refer to the Defence Business Services National Security Vetting (DBS NSV) Agency.
